Answer:
Kylie's grandfather is 73 years old.
Step-by-step explanation:
Let the first digit in Kylie's grandfather's age be x, which is the age of Isaac
Let the second digit in Kylie's grandfather's age be y, which is the age of Kendra.
Therefore from the given information we can say that
(10x + y) + x + y = 83
therefore 11x + 2y = 83
Let us take x = 7 then we get 77 + 2y = 83
y = 3
Therefore we can say Issac's age is 7
and Kendra's age is 3
and the age of Kylie's grandfather is 73.
